The 16th Children’s Concert at Stanborough Park Church is raising £5,000 to support an education project for Uma Uain Craic School in Viqueque, Timor-Leste.
Since its beginning in 2011, the concert has been built on the inspiring idea that “Children helping less fortunate children.” Now in its 16th year, the concert continues to bring young people together through music while making a meaningful difference in the lives of children around the world.
This year, 65 children have dedicated months of hard work and practice to prepare a wonderful programme of ensemble performances in support of the school. Through their music, they hope to help provide better educational opportunities and resources for the children of Uma Uain Craic School.
